TPS Sensor Adjustment Mod
 
does it do anything noticable?

smellbird 06-19-2004 01:43 AM

It wont make you car any faster, just make you accelerate faster with less pressure on the pedal, if that makes sense.

willwren 06-19-2004 12:31 PM

A resistor will do the same. It's called a "TPS Enhancer" and makes the PCM think you've pressed the pedal harder than you think. My Jet Stage 2 does this among other things.
